The LT3060MPTS8-3.3#TRPBF operates based on the principle of linear regulation. It uses a pass transistor to regulate the output voltage by adjusting the resistance between the input and output terminals. This allows it to maintain a stable output voltage despite variations in the input voltage.

Sure! Here are 10 common questions and answers related to the application of LT3060MPTS8-3.3#TRPBF in technical solutions:
Q: What is the LT3060MPTS8-3.3#TRPBF? A: The LT3060MPTS8-3.3#TRPBF is a low dropout voltage linear regulator IC.
Q: What is the input voltage range for the LT3060MPTS8-3.3#TRPBF? A: The input voltage range is from 1.8V to 45V.
Q: What is the output voltage of the LT3060MPTS8-3.3#TRPBF? A: The output voltage is fixed at 3.3V.
Q: What is the maximum output current of the LT3060MPTS8-3.3#TRPBF? A: The maximum output current is 100mA.
Q: Can the LT3060MPTS8-3.3#TRPBF be used in battery-powered applications? A: Yes, it can be used in battery-powered applications as it has a low quiescent current of 45µA.
Q: Does the LT3060MPTS8-3.3#TRPBF require any external components for operation? A: Yes, it requires an input capacitor and an output capacitor for stability.
Q: Is the LT3060MPTS8-3.3#TRPBF suitable for automotive applications? A: Yes, it is suitable for automotive applications as it can withstand automotive load dump transients.
Q: Can the LT3060MPTS8-3.3#TRPBF operate in a wide temperature range? A: Yes, it can operate in a temperature range of -40°C to 125°C.
Q: What is the dropout voltage of the LT3060MPTS8-3.3#TRPBF? A: The dropout voltage is typically 300mV at full load.
Q: Is the LT3060MPTS8-3.3#TRPBF available in a surface mount package? A: Yes, it is available in a surface mount package (SOT-23-8).
